Turkey Creek
Turkey Creek is a stream in Wyoming, West Virginia. Turkey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Marianna, as well as near the village Brenton.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Brenton
Village
Brenton is a census-designated place in Wyoming County, West Virginia, United States. As of the 2020 census, its population was 194. Sue Cline, West Virginia State Senator and businesswoman, lived in Brenton.
Wyoming
Hamlet
Wyoming is an unincorporated community in Wyoming County, West Virginia, United States. It gets its name from the counties name. Wyoming sits along the Guyandotte River. Wyoming has a post office and a Methodist church.
